Champions cup Live
Tier Draw:
Tier 1: Exeter, Scarlets, Clermont Munster, Wasps
Tier 2: Saracens, Leinster, La Rochelle, RC Toulon, Racing 92
Tier 3: Bath, Ulster, Montpillier, Leicester Tigers, Ospreys,
Tier 4: Harlequins, Glasgow, Castres, Treviso, Northampton Saints
 
Pool Draw:
Pool 1: Wasps, La Rochelle, Ulster, Harlequins
Pool 2: Clermont, Saracens, Ospreys, Northampton Saints
Pool 3: Exeter Chiefs, Leinster, Montpelier, Glasgow Warriors,
Pool 4: Munster, Racing 92, Leicester Tigers, Castres,
Pool 5: Scarlets, Toulon, Bath, Benetton,
